zeke7 @ 2008-02-14 18:12:54
zeke7 pictureGator Loops, Lachlung La
zeke7 @ 2008-02-14 17:05:39
zeke7 pictureRed star on a mountain
That's China's PRC logo, on the hillside of Ali, capital of Ngari prefecture in western Tibet. The town houses a sizable military contingent.
zeke7 @ 2008-02-14 03:15:52
zeke7 pictureCamp on Mt Everest
This is Everest Base Camp - Nepal, where most of today's Everest expeditions are based.